#58cf96 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#58cf96 is composed of 34.5% red, 81.2% green and 58.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 57.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 27.5% yellow and 18.8% black. It has a hue angle of 151.3 degrees, a saturation of 55.3% and a lightness of 57.8%. #58cf96 color hex could be obtained by blending #b0ffff with #009f2d. Closest websafe color is: #66cc99.

Shades and Tints of #58cf96

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000100 is the darkest color, while #f0fbf6 is the lightest one.
